
Python
Enthought Canopy 是一个基于 Python 3 的集成开发环境(IDE),它提供了一个友好的界面和强大的功能,使得 Python 编程变得更加简单和高效。在 Canopy 中,我们可以进行代码编辑、调试和运行,同时还可以使用丰富的科学计算库和数据分析工具进行数据处理和可视化。
使用 Canopy 进行 Python 编程首先,我们需要下载并安装 Enthought Canopy。安装完成后,我们可以打开 Canopy 并创建一个新的 Python 3 项目。在项目中,我们可以创建一个 Python 脚本文件,然后就可以开始编写代码了。下面是一个简单的例子,展示了如何在 Canopy 中使用 Python 3 进行编程:Python# 导入所需的库import numpy as npimport matplotlib.pyplot as plt# 创建一个 NumPy 数组x = np.linspace(0, 2*np.pi, 100)y = np.sin(x)# 绘制正弦曲线plt.plot(x, y)plt.xlabel('x')plt.ylabel('y')plt.title('Sin Curve')# 显示图形plt.show()在这个例子中,我们首先导入了 numpy 和 matplotlib.pyplot 这两个库,它们分别用于数据处理和数据可视化。然后,我们创建了一个包含 100 个元素的数组 x,并使用 np.sin() 函数计算了相应的正弦值,并将结果存储在数组 y 中。接下来,我们使用 matplotlib.pyplot 库绘制了正弦曲线。通过调用 plt.plot() 函数并传入 x 和 y 数组,我们可以绘制出对应的曲线。然后,我们使用 plt.xlabel()、plt.ylabel() 和 plt.title() 函数分别设置了 x 轴、y 轴和标题的标签。最后,我们调用 plt.show() 函数显示了绘制出的图形。 Canopy 的优势 Enthought Canopy 提供了许多优势,使得它成为 Python 编程的理想选择。首先,Canopy 提供了一个集成的开发环境,使得代码的编辑、调试和运行变得更加简单和高效。它具有友好的界面和直观的操作方式,即使对于初学者来说也很容易上手。其次,Canopy 预装了许多常用的科学计算库和数据分析工具,如 NumPy、Pandas、Matplotlib 等。这些库可以帮助我们进行数据处理、数值计算、统计分析和可视化等任务,大大提高了我们的工作效率。此外,Canopy 还提供了强大的代码提示和自动补全功能,可以帮助我们快速编写正确的代码。它还支持多种插件和扩展,可以根据个人需求进行定制和扩展。Enthought Canopy 是一个功能强大的 Python 3 集成开发环境,它提供了丰富的功能和友好的界面,使得 Python 编程变得更加简单和高效。通过 Canopy,我们可以轻松编写、调试和运行 Python 代码,并使用各种科学计算库和数据分析工具进行数据处理和可视化。无论是初学者还是专业开发人员,Canopy 都是一个值得推荐的工具。Copyright © 2025 IZhiDa.com All Rights Reserved.
知答 版权所有 粤ICP备2023042255号